Output 29e8e706fc57d7a8a64f924c95009bc83be7ecf2b0f6fe7d1817b2991d53d9ea:5

value
589160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61353a2cc237908fb8adc243241fe1da6b657d87 OP_EQUAL
address
3AZ1ESmkgn79jpBQQMyhBnrRJPrfhE6A8Y
transaction
29e8e706fc57d7a8a64f924c95009bc83be7ecf2b0f6fe7d1817b2991d53d9ea
spent
true